Job Description

We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Engineer to join our Construction Engineering Services team. The ideal candidate will play a key role in supporting various aspects of the construction process, contributing to innovative design engineering, reviewing structural calculations, developing plans, and ensuring the safety of our construction crews. As a crucial member of our growing team, you will collaborate with Project Management and Estimators to provide on-site engineering and coordination support, adding value to the success of our client's projects.

Responsibilities:

Develop drawings and calculations for temporary works and construction methods, including:
Heavy lift plans (site logistics, equipment selection, geometry/feasibility studies, design of custom rigging and lifting devices, hoisting and jacking systems, custom tools, and crane pad/working surface designs)
Erection procedures or planned sequences related to construction or demolition operations
Evaluation of existing structures for construction loads and/or demolition planning
Structural analysis to ensure stability during the temporary condition of new bridges, viaducts, buildings, tunnels, and other structures (e.g., construction staging, design of temporary falsework systems, and rebar cage hoisting and support)
Support of excavation systems or cofferdams for construction below-grade
Temporary bridges, trestles, work platforms, fall protection systems, formwork, and other features relating to our construction operations
Perform and/or review others' calculations and design drawings according to industry codes, standards, additional client design criteria, and structural theories
Ensure quality and accuracy of the design deliverables
Identify design risks and assist with risk mitigation planning
Assist in Project Management and Estimators (budgets, schedules, quality control, and coordination/communication with clients)
Provide project on-site design engineering support, conduct on-site inspections, and mentor E.I.T.'s
